General
Your general opinion of this product.
I'm a huge fan of harmonizing and love the built in loop recording. It allows me to harmonize with myself without using the smart harmony feature. It also allows me to play lead over a pre-recorded rythm.
Playability and Feel
How does it feel, Heavy, Fast, Chunky? How was the neck? Are the controls easy to get to while playing?
Yes. Its a modeling amp...you can make it sound however you want. There is also a free update at the line 6 website that adds an extra 25 or so effects.
Tone
Bright and snappy? Dark and smooth? Were the pickups hot, mellow, thick, thin?
Its a modeling amp...you can create just about any tone. The back of the cab is not ported...its completely sealed so the bass doesnt project the way my spider III does, I may customize it by adding a port.
